Frequently Asked Questions about York County

How much are Studio apartments in York County?

There are currently 64 Studio Apartments in York County with rent ranges from $951 to $1,500 with an average price of $1,641.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om York County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in York County ranges from $775 to $3,223 with an average monthly rent of $1,368.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in York County c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in York County range from $915 to $3,582.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,622.

How expensive are York County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 115 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in York County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,025 to $4,216 - averaging $1,840 for the location.
